Eugene Ionesco, the renowned Romanian-French playwright known for his absurdist and avant-garde works, was a firm believer in the power of literature and the importance of reading. In his view, people who do not read are akin to brutes, lacking in intellectual curiosity and cultural awareness.

Ionesco's plays often explore themes of alienation, conformity, and the absurdity of human existence. Through his characters and dialogue, he challenges societal norms and questions the meaning of life. Central to his work is the idea that knowledge and understanding can only be gained through reading and self-reflection.

For Ionesco, reading is not just a pastime or a form of entertainment, but a fundamental aspect of being human. It is through reading that we expand our minds, broaden our perspectives, and engage with the world around us. Those who do not read, in his eyes, are limiting themselves and missing out on the richness and complexity of life.

In his play "The Bald Soprano," Ionesco satirizes the banality and emptiness of everyday conversation, highlighting the absurdity of human communication. The characters in the play are trapped in a cycle of meaningless dialogue, unable to connect with each other on a deeper level. This lack of meaningful communication is a reflection of the characters' inability to engage with the world through reading and intellectual pursuits.
